The Crawford House is a historic Queen Anne-style residence constructed in 1899, located in Steamboat Springs, Colorado. Although it is a private residence and not open to the public, visitors can admire its distinctive architectural details from the street, including ornate woodwork, asymmetrical facade, and steeply pitched roof. The house stands as a well-preserved example of late Victorian-era design in the mountain town.
